Concordia Shanghai Students Win Gold at International iGEM Competition in Paris

SHANGHAI, Nov. 11, 2025 /PRNewswire/ — Concordia International School Shanghai’s high school iGEM team earned a Gold Medal at the prestigious 2025 International Genetically Engineered Machine (iGEM) Competition in Paris, the world’s premier synthetic biology event.

The team’s achievement was further recognized with a nomination for the “Best Environment Award” at the Grand Jamboree, held at the Paris Convention Centre. There, the students presented their innovative approach to tackling one of today’s most pressing environmental challenges: plastic waste.

Guided by Mr. David Doyle, Applied Learning Synthetic Biology teacher at Concordia Shanghai, 17 student researchers spent the past 10 months designing, building, and testing genetically engineered bacterial cells capable of converting plastic waste into valuable products. Their project, titled PURPLE (Plastic Upcycling, Reducing Pollution, Looping the Economy), offers an eco-friendly alternative to traditional recycling methods that avoids toxic byproducts and greenhouse gas emissions.

Demonstrating responsible scientific innovation, the team conducted a Life Cycle Analysis and dual-use risk assessments to ensure the safety and sustainability of their approach. They also developed a business plan for bringing their bio-based products to market and created an educational outreach program that makes synthetic biology accessible to high school students.
